Type
ORACLE
Validation date
2024-12-07 11:24:20 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(37 B)

{
  "uco": {
    "eur": 0.02036,
    "usd": 0.02152
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

00011A5638C203813545BC9D7BE3B81B6D679B6318806DCF193687CEED147297F4FE

Previous signature

EE3766943A810D400D3B98F2F044AFA29EB1B86EB52C9E4DDB561321238C81D9C32F295E685023B5F1E8223B79EB45D8E47776C57C0C515C9E3090AE64ADB709

Origin signature

304502207ABADF791418EC690D7B486576D32248D8CB24ED9CD924144F206D87DF2B440D0221008E7AC303DA0215D08B799DA89D77FF2E271A2A178673CCE23230E0BEB78AB5A6

Proof of work

010104EB90F7BDD03D5A7FD9B61D9128D7CF24C11F3F7DA96825DA3680C2B6BCC48F1AFCE26E0A5F1A903EDAA4BC9390210A0A4F175847EC2A2BB325BB6D1CE8EC8F90

Proof of integrity

00217F60D7FB44641F131090934F9421B3970DB3D1C3005070444A2E1BA1C73651

Coordinator signature

3CDBEA0EF068A70ECDACF11AB832397A7C47D40F000DA1EEF190F9265BE52AAFA1F40E43B89D06D62D9D4A822AA936990D21FDBA3BB2AE8EE69C81492414B505

Validator #1 public key

00013D16BDF02C72DB6831A1EB14200C6D5427B4303351645BDFFC9B132DFE3A53FC

Validator #1 signature

CDDE36BB8BBC9DB07C3F163C6ABD48D175AC2BA44AC8CD8EF2545B3CAD3D44C7072A4DC548988A2A2119581856166D11A05713F4932757F749AF2FD0F2B43004

Validator #2 public key

00013F0000490CECA80A76E7199D7B53E23583A16E24EF761384EC642713056C33D7

Validator #2 signature

370ABEFB957CABB3602F8C08E5A29A3D5F7F0AE4F2BD2517C15EDDD8C97786C5C3E9740E28A8B843D220400322A31BC3351BCE5B407431868695A5C8080B1702